当前位置:首页 / EXCEL

Excel如何准确区分不同天数?如何快速计算天数差异?

作者:佚名|分类:EXCEL|浏览:168|发布时间:2025-04-15 13:05:51

Excel如何准确区分不同天数?如何快速计算天数差异?

在Excel中,处理日期和时间数据是一项常见的任务。准确地区分不同天数以及快速计算天数差异对于数据分析、财务报告和项目管理等领域至关重要。以下是如何在Excel中实现这些功能的详细步骤和技巧。

一、准确区分不同天数

在Excel中,日期被视为数字,其中1900年1月1日是序列号1。因此,两个日期之间的差异可以通过简单的减法来计算。

1. 输入日期

首先,确保你的单元格格式设置为日期格式。在Excel中,可以通过以下步骤设置单元格格式:

选择包含日期的单元格。

点击“开始”选项卡。

在“数字”组中,选择“日期”格式。

2. 输入日期值

在单元格中输入日期值。例如,输入“2023/1/1”或“1/1/2023”等。

3. 区分不同天数

如果你想区分不同的天数,比如比较两个日期之间的天数差异,你可以使用以下公式:

```excel

=END_DATE START_DATE

```

其中,`END_DATE` 是结束日期,`START_DATE` 是开始日期。例如,如果你想计算从2023年1月1日到2023年1月10日的天数,你可以这样写:

```excel

=DATE(2023,1,10) DATE(2023,1,1)

```

这将返回9,表示这两个日期之间有9天。

二、快速计算天数差异

1. 使用DAYS函数

Excel的DAYS函数可以直接计算两个日期之间的天数差异,无需手动减法。

```excel

=DAYS(START_DATE, END_DATE)

```

例如,如果你想计算从2023年1月1日到2023年1月10日的天数,可以使用以下公式:

```excel

=DAYS(DATE(2023,1,1), DATE(2023,1,10))

```

2. 使用DATEDIF函数

DATEDIF函数可以更灵活地计算两个日期之间的天数差异,包括部分天数。

```excel

=DATEDIF(START_DATE, END_DATE, "D")

```

这里的"D"参数表示计算两个日期之间的天数差异。

三、实例操作

假设你有一个包含开始日期和结束日期的表格,如下所示:

| 开始日期 | 结束日期 |

|----------|----------|

| 2023/1/1 | 2023/1/10|

| 2023/1/15| 2023/1/20|

| 2023/2/1 | 2023/2/15|

要计算每个日期对的天数差异,可以在“天数差异”列中使用以下公式:

```excel

=DAYS(B2, C2)

```

将此公式向下拖动以填充整个列。

相关问答

1. 如何处理跨年的日期差异计算?

跨年的日期差异计算与普通日期差异计算方法相同。Excel会自动处理跨年的日期差异。

2. 如果我需要计算两个日期之间的完整工作日,应该使用哪个函数?

对于计算完整工作日,可以使用WORKDAY函数。例如:

```excel

=WORKDAY(START_DATE, END_DATE)

```

这个函数会自动排除周末,并可以根据需要排除特定的节假日。

3. 如何在Excel中显示日期差异的格式?

在Excel中,你可以通过设置单元格格式来显示日期差异的格式。例如,如果你想显示天数,可以将单元格格式设置为“常规”或“数字”,并确保小数点后没有数字。

通过以上步骤和技巧,你可以在Excel中准确地区分不同天数并快速计算天数差异,从而提高你的数据分析效率。